Jean-Christophe Cambadélis

Jean-Christophe Cambadélis (born 14 August 1951) is a French politician who was First Secretary of the French Socialist Party from April 2014 till June 2017.[1] He was a member of the National Assembly of France, born in Neuilly-sur-Seine. He represented the city of Paris,[2] as a member of the Socialist, Republican & Citizen. He is of Greek ancestry.
